Reporting obligation for: Riverine Inputs and Direct Discharges Monitoring Programme (Agreement 2014-04)

Title
Riverine Inputs and Direct Discharges Monitoring Programme (Agreement 2014-04)
Description
The main objectives of RID are:
To assess, as accurately as possible, all river-borne and direct inputs of selected pollutants to Convention waters on an annual basis.
To contribute to the implementation of the Joint Assessment and Monitoring Programme (JAMP) by providing data on inputs to Convention waters on a sub-regional and a regional level.
To report these data annually to the OSPAR Commission and:
a. to review these data periodically with a view to determining temporal trends;
b. to review on a regular basis, to be determined by the Hazardous Substances and Eutrophication Committee (HASEC), whether RID requires revision.

The RID results are to be reported to the Secretariat by 1 November (30 November for Denmark only) each year and reviewed by the Working Group on Inputs to the Marine Environment (INPUT) or by task groups established for this purpose, through the following:
Text report: The reporting template is given in Appendix II.
Data report: Contracting Parties will receive the appropriate templates for data submission by e-mail at the beginning of September of the reporting year, with information on the current reporting procedure.
Statistical information on river catchment areas (Appendix III).
